Texas attorney general probes Lululemon over potential ’forever chemicals’ in its activewear

AUSTIN, Texas – The Texas Attorney General's office has initiated an investigation into Lululemon Athletica Inc., a leading athletic apparel retailer, regarding the potential presence of per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) in its activewear products. This development, confirmed today, May 19, 2026, marks a significant escalation in regulatory oversight of consumer goods and their chemical components, particularly within the booming athletic apparel sector.

The probe centers on whether Lululemon's products contain these persistent chemicals, which have garnered widespread attention for their environmental longevity and potential health risks. PFAS are a group of man-made chemicals used in various industrial and consumer products for their water, grease, and stain-resistant properties. While highly effective, their resistance to degradation has earned them the moniker “forever chemicals,” as they can accumulate in the environment and human body over time. The investigation is expected to scrutinize Lululemon's manufacturing processes, supply chain transparency, and product disclosures related to these substances.

Growing Concerns Over PFAS in Consumer Products

This inquiry by the Texas Attorney General underscores a growing national and international concern over PFAS. Regulatory bodies and consumer advocacy groups have increasingly focused on the prevalence of these chemicals in everyday items, from non-stick cookware to food packaging and textiles. The potential health impacts associated with PFAS exposure, including certain cancers, developmental issues, and immune system disruptions, have prompted calls for stricter regulations and bans on their use. For Lululemon, a brand built on a reputation for quality and wellness, such an investigation could significantly impact consumer trust and brand perception.

While details of the Texas Attorney General's specific queries to Lululemon remain under wraps, it is anticipated that the investigation will seek information on the company's chemical sourcing, testing protocols, and any efforts made to eliminate PFAS from its product lines. The scope of activewear items under scrutiny is also a key unknown, potentially encompassing a wide range of popular products from yoga pants to jackets and accessories. This type of investigation is not without precedent; other consumer goods companies have faced similar inquiries and lawsuits regarding PFAS content in recent years, leading to product reformulations and enhanced labeling requirements.

Broader Implications for the Apparel Industry

Lululemon's substantial market presence means that this investigation could send ripple effects throughout the entire athletic apparel and broader fashion industry. Many brands utilize water-repellent and stain-resistant finishes that historically have relied on PFAS. Should the investigation reveal significant findings, it could trigger a broader industry-wide push towards developing and adopting PFAS-free alternatives. This would necessitate considerable investment in research and development, as well as adjustments to global supply chains.

Competitors and suppliers will undoubtedly be watching this development closely. The outcome could set a precedent for how chemical safety is regulated in textiles and prompt other states or federal agencies to launch similar probes. For consumers, the news could heighten awareness about the chemicals in their clothing, driving demand for more transparent product information and sustainably manufactured goods. The long-term implications for Lululemon, depending on the findings, could range from mandatory product changes and financial penalties to potential class-action lawsuits.

What Lies Ahead for Lululemon

Lululemon has not yet released a public statement regarding the Texas Attorney General's investigation. The immediate next steps will likely involve the company cooperating fully with the inquiry, providing requested documentation, and potentially conducting internal reviews of its chemical management policies. The legal process could be protracted, involving extensive data collection, expert testimony, and potentially negotiations or legal challenges depending on the agency's findings.

This probe serves as a crucial reminder for all consumer product companies to proactively assess their chemical footprints and prioritize the elimination of potentially harmful substances from their supply chains. As environmental and health consciousness continues to grow among consumers, transparency and a commitment to safe, sustainable practices are becoming paramount for maintaining brand value and market leadership. The findings of this investigation could significantly shape the future landscape of chemical regulation in the apparel industry for years to come.
